The Baylor College of Medicine and the University of Texas Medical Branch in Galveston were the only medical schools in Texas to survive Abraham Flexner's stern criticisms of low standards of medical education in his harsh and famous report of 1911. Baylor College of Medicine and the Central Texas Veterans Health Care System in Temple, Texas, announced today a new affiliation where the VA will serve as one of the teaching hospitals for medical students training at the new Baylor College of Medicine School of Medicine regional campus in Temple.
